Painful cramps.?


Question:
Does anyone else out there get really painful cramps the first day of their period? I always do and I find that it interferes a lot with my schedule, even if I've taken a midol I still feel sick and end up sleeping for hour. I find if I'm in class some days are so bad I can't just sit there, so I leave. Who else has problems with this?

Answers:
I have painful period cramps that has interfered with my life basically on a weekly if not daily basis over the last 6 months. I have missed more days at work than I have really been allowed to, but luckily I have an understanding boss.

If it is that painful for you and it interferes with your day to day things, you should definitely go see a gyneacologist. You might have endometriosis which is something a lot of women have and painful periods are a very common symptom of it.

Get your Mom to take you to the gyneacologist for a check up just to make sure - better to find out sooner and get it seen to than wait and suffer not knowing.

Good luck!
Maybe you could try taking Advil around the clock the day before your period starts. You could also try one of those small, adhesive heating pads on your abdomen. My last suggestion would be to try oral contraceptives; that works for some people. I had really bad cramps when I was younger but as I get older they are much less.
